Professional Experience at Amazon
Peng Gao worked at Amazon for an extensive period, holding multiple roles from 2010 to 2021. Initially, he was a Software Development Engineer based in Beijing, China for four years. He then transitioned to a Lead Software Development Engineer position in Greater Seattle Area, a role he held from 2014 to 2017. Subsequently, he served as a Senior Software Engineer in Greater Seattle Area until 2021. During his tenure, Peng became a Samurai member and a Bar Raiser, contributing significantly to the organization's engineering processes and cultural excellence.
